ISLAMABAD: Police have arrested the suspect involved in the brutal murder of a 23-year-old female student of the International Islamic University Islamabad (IIUI). The student, Eman Afroz, was shot inside her private hostel room located in Sector G-10/1 of the capital.
Addressing a press conference, Islamabad DIG Jawad Tariq said the suspect, Feroze, is a resident of Jhang and had been on the run since the incident. He was finally arrested after a detailed investigation.
According to reports, on April 19, the accused climbed the hostel wall with a pistol in hand and remained in the courtyard for about an hour. When the student saw him and walked away, he followed her and forcefully entered her room. Three other girls were present in the room at the time. He threatened them to remain quiet and then opened fire on Eman, seriously injuring her.
The suspect escaped by jumping the wall again. Eman was rushed to the hospital but died due to her injuries.

Ramna police registered a case on the complaint of Eman’s brother and launched an investigation. Police revealed that the suspect has a criminal record and has previously been charged in rape and motorcycle theft cases.
DIG Jawad Tariq confirmed that further investigation is ongoing and a complete challan will be submitted based on strong evidence.
Meanwhile, IG Islamabad Syed Ali Nasir Rizvi appreciated the police officers who quickly solved Eman’s case and other high-profile cases like the Sana Yousaf murder.
